lua wrapper: Fix bash error
Recently, we made it harder for external code to use some stdenv-only bash variables by unsetting them in [1] But Lua's `withPackages` was sourcing some setup hooks in [2], which required those bash variables. I say great! We caught something bad: Lua should use normal dependencies, even though that is harder with `buildEnv`. Now it works that way, and everything is fine.
